Overview

Situated a mere 1.4 km from Nairn Dunbar Golf Club, the 3-star Havelock Hotel Nairn features Wi-Fi in public areas, and a free private car park on site. Area attractions, including Nairn Museum, are located just moments from this hotel.

Location

The centre of Nairn is a 5 minutes' walk of the accommodation. Nairn United Reformed Church is a mere 1.4 km from the hotel and Inverness airport is 15 km away. Nature lovers will appreciate the proximity to East Beach, which is around 10 minutes away by car. The Havelock Hotel is around a 20-minute walk from RSPB Culbin Sands.

The accommodation is also quite close to High Street bus stop.

Rooms

Some of the spacious rooms of the property face the sea, and comprise an adjoining terrace and a balcony. They come equipped with a coffeemaker for self-catering along with a flat-screen television for business and leisure. Offering amenities such as complimentary toiletries, the bathrooms also feature a bathtub and a walk-in shower.

Eat & Drink

There is a restaurant for guests to enjoy their meal. Drinks are available at the lounge bar. It overlooks the sea. Strathnairn Beach Cafe is just a 14-minute walk from this Nairn hotel.

Leisure & Business

The Havelock has a sundeck, a terrace, and various recreational opportunities.
